Fans of Sir Paul McCartney were thrilled when he provided a peek behind the scenes of his latest album announcement. The legendary Beatles icon is reconnecting with his Merseyside roots through his upcoming record, The Boys of Dungeon Lane, scheduled for release on May 29.At 83, the music legend is embracing nostalgia with this new collection of songs, reflecting on his early years in Liverpool before his stratospheric success with the Fab Four. Dungeon Lane references a street in Speke where the young McCartney would pass endless hours playing and watching birds. The album’s debut single, Days We Left Behind, was released last month and features the lyric that inspired the record’s name.
